Help & User's Guide
The database contains photographs of plants from Central Africa in a broad geographical sense, mainly from the rain forest regions.
- You can search for scientific or vernacular names (or parts thereof, no wildcard necessary) via free text (in: “What are you looking for”)
- You can browse through a taxonomic hierarchy starting with family names.
- You can select several morphological characters and will get a result list of species we have encoded to have these characters.
The search is filtered according to the chosen character states. Chosen character states for the same character are combined with a logical “OR”, returning a list of plants with any of the chosen character states (flowers, e.g., may be red OR yellow).
Different characters, however, are combined with a logical “AND”, returning a list of plants, where the character states fit the selections for every character (e.g., only plants, with red flowers AND entire leaf margins).
Please note that the informations for character coding are taken from the literature and that not all of these characters will be visible on the photographs.
The photo guide is an aid to identification but cannot substitute an identification key. Definition of characters is rough and includes only easily visible or accessible features.
